Be There For Your Loved Ones
There's a common misconception that Life insurance is only needed when you get older, but even if you are young and just rented your first place, now could be the right time to start talking about Life insurance.

Life Insurance Options To Fit Your Needs
Coverage from State Farm helps you rest easy knowing your family will be taken care of even if the worst comes to pass. Because most young families rely on dual incomes, the loss of one salary can be completely devastating. With the high costs of raising children, life insurance is critically important for young families. Even if you don't work outside the home, the costs of covering housekeeping or domestic responsibilities can be a heavy weight. For those who don't have children, you may have aging parents who rely on your income or be planning to have children someday.
